Transaction 1384b3deeaad584bac4b703940e454c1114bc3e43e671504d79acf92dd471527
1 Input
1 Output
-
1384b3deeaad584bac4b703940e454c1114bc3e43e671504d79acf92dd471527:0
- value
- 29976960
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2f9772ce3dc6edbafd3589b15c732366f74cafb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JmvwPGTz2KHbzFbf4gURjW7k2x7LQxGLg